Recommended bowl: Smooth double soup

Hayashi has been one of the best ramen shops within easy walking distance of Shibuya Station since its debut in 2003. The master, Hayashi-san, does all of the cooking himself, while his wife handles the customers. The shop interior has a very contemporary Tokyo feel – just one long counter packed with salarymen slurping down noodles during their lunch break.

The soup is a silky double broth of tonkotsu and shoyu with gyokai. It's rich, but totally drinkable. The pork and egg toppings are both money. Best of all: a small slice of yuzu rind placed on top. The citrus slowly permeates the soup, giving the bowl a wonderful fragrance. Hayashi is only open for lunch and there’s a line at the door every day.
